Understanding Calcium Hypochlorite: Composition and Properties

Calcium hypochlorite (Ca(OCl)₂) is an inorganic compound widely recognized for its powerful oxidizing and disinfecting capabilities. This white granular or tablet-form chemical releases chlorine when dissolved in water, making it exceptionally effective for sterilization and purification processes.

Key Chemical Characteristics

  • Molecular Weight: 142.98 g/mol
  • Available Chlorine Content: 65-70% for high-grade formulations
  • Solubility: Moderately soluble in water
  • Stability: Stable under proper storage conditions
  • pH Range: Alkaline when dissolved (10-11)

Laboratory-grade calcium hypochlorite undergoes rigorous purification processes to eliminate impurities that could interfere with sensitive analytical procedures or compromise experimental results.

High Precision Purification Grades for Laboratory Use

Not all calcium hypochlorite products are created equal. Laboratory applications demand specific purity levels that exceed industrial or commercial grades.

Analytical Reagent Grade (AR Grade)

This premium classification ensures minimal contamination from heavy metals, insoluble matter, and other interfering substances. AR grade calcium hypochlorite is ideal for:

  • Quantitative chemical analysis
  • Standard solution preparation
  • Quality control testing
  • Research and development projects

Technical Grade vs. Laboratory Grade

While technical grade serves general disinfection purposes, laboratory grade undergoes additional purification steps including recrystallization, filtration, and stringent quality testing. The difference manifests in consistency, reproducibility, and reliability of experimental outcomes.

Storage and Safety Considerations

Optimal Storage Conditions

Proper storage maintains product integrity and extends shelf life:

  • Temperature: Store between 15-25°C (59-77°F)
  • Humidity: Keep in dry conditions below 60% relative humidity
  • Ventilation: Ensure adequate airflow in storage areas
  • Separation: Store away from acids, organic materials, and reducing agents

Safety Protocols

Laboratory personnel must follow established safety guidelines:

  • Wear appropriate personal protective equipment (PPE)
  • Use in well-ventilated areas or fume hoods
  • Implement spill containment procedures
  • Maintain emergency eyewash and shower stations
  • Train staff on proper handling and disposal methods

Shelf Life Management

High-quality calcium hypochlorite maintains effectiveness for 12-24 months when stored properly. Implement first-in-first-out (FIFO) inventory rotation to maximize product usability.

Laboratory Applications of Calcium Hypochlorite

Water Quality Analysis

Calcium hypochlorite serves as a standard disinfectant for water sample preservation and treatment protocol validation in environmental testing laboratories.

Surface Sterilization

Laboratory workspaces, equipment, and containment areas require regular disinfection to prevent cross-contamination between experiments.

Biological Sample Processing

Certain protocols utilize calcium hypochlorite solutions for decontaminating biological materials before disposal or further processing.

Chemical Synthesis

As an oxidizing agent, calcium hypochlorite participates in various organic and inorganic synthesis reactions requiring controlled oxidation conditions.

Q3: Can calcium hypochlorite be shipped internationally?

A: Yes, but it requires classification as a hazardous material (Class 5.1 Oxidizer). Suppliers must comply with IMDG, IATA, and local transportation regulations.
